    Anyone have an idea what he's doing to close the hi hats on those blast riffs? It doesn't look like he's moving his heel over to grab it...

    • @BurnTheNuance
      @BurnTheNuance 6 років тому +7

      Geworfen Heit I saw them on the 16th and got him to toss me one of his sticks! Believe it or not but he uses the front of his foot while he blasts. The hats are so tight that you only hear the "chick" when he hits them, but he's constantly using the hi-hat pedal when he does for a few seconds before he actuates them. He blew my mind their entire band did. I've seen over a 100 different bands and them and Fetus are always my favorites. Also, he actually has his hi-hat pedal to the right of his left foot board instead of on the left like most guys (he has one of those fancy hi-hat stand that you can extend the pedal like two feet and place it wherever). It makes his technique easier. To clear it up since it's on the right side all he has to do is move half of his left foot into the hi-hat so he can use both. It was fucking incredible to watch live.     2:20 a drummers nightmare number 1, however, his double base playing is fake as shit. I see what trigger he's using to make it seem like it's twice the speed it is

    • @todgym5671
      @todgym5671 4 роки тому +1

      jason byrne The triggers are irrelevant, he’s playing heel toe double strokes which looks like his legs are playing halftime but in reality he is playing every note heard. Please let me know if any of that was confusing, I may have explained it poorly
